New York City has been home to a positively booming boutique fitness scene for several years now. The city that never sleeps has a reputation for attracting dreamers and doers from all over the world. This population of highly motivated individuals with ambition to spare has made the city a veritable hotspot for bold new fitness locales and techniques. Now, that infectious energy has spread to the Hamptons.
Studios like Barry’s Bootcamp, SoulCycle, and Tracy Anderson have begun to open pop-ups out East until Labor Day. These locations join homegrown gems like the original Yoga Shanti in Sag Harbor. Here are some of the best fitness studios in the Hamptons so you can stay fit and energized all summer long.
Southampton
Barry’s Bootcamp
While Barry has numerous Bootcamp locations throughout the Hamptons and the larger New York area, this studio in Southampton is the largest. With 25 treadmills, 25 benches, and a massive seating area, this boot camp is ready to accommodate untold numbers of locals looking to get their fitness routines on track.
10 Montauk Highway, Southampton, barrysbootcamp.com
Brownings Fitness
Star fitness guru Mary Ann Browning offers personal, hands-on training and classes featuring the ElliptiGO. It’s an intense, high-octane workout, but one that gets the job done.
60 Windmill Lane, Southampton, browningsfitness.com

Bridgehampton/Water Mill
Taryn Toomey
Led by Taryn Toomey, this class takes her beloved calisthenics and plyometrics classes and brings them to the Hamptons with style. This summer, the brand-new studio will be opening in Bridgehampton on May 25th.
264 Butter Lane, Bridgehampton, https://taryntoomey.com/the-hamptons/
Exhale Core Fusion
A good barre class is hard to find in the Hamptons—and here, you can take classes with the Core Fusion founders themselves, famed barre gurus Fred DeVito and Elisabeth Halfpapp.
2415 Main St., Bridgehampton, exhalespa.com
One Ocean Yoga
Fresh-air yoga in a pretty tent overlooking a vineyard. This scenic workout is full of relaxation and immense emotional well-being benefits.
1927 Scuttle Hole Road, Bridgehampton, oneoceanyoga.com
Physique 57
Follow the fashion crowd to this beloved barre studio’s only East End location for some indoor waterskiing and thigh dancing.
264 Butter Lane, Bridgehampton, physique57.com

East Hampton/Wainscott
DanceBody
Dance cardio star Katia Pryce teaches dance classes that are both infectiously joyful and surprisingly difficult. Her goal is to keep you moving at such a rapid pace that you don’t even notice how hard you’re pushing yourself.
15 Lumber Lane, East Hampton, dancebody.com
East End Row
Rowing is one of the most strenuous and intense workouts you can ask for. On paper, it may seem like an arm-focused exercise routine, but in execution, it is the kind of unrivaled full-body workout that is bound to leave you sore and aching for more.
460 Pantigo Rd., East Hampton, eastendrow.com
Flywheel
The brand’s Hamptons location is open year-round and offers both cycling and FlyBarre classes.
65 Montauk Highway, East Hampton, flywheelsports.com
SLT
SLT provides the only two locations in the Hamptons where fitness enthusiasts can hop on a muscle-torturing, body-sculpting Megaformer.
460 Pantiago Road, East Hampton, sltnyc.com
SoulCycle East Hampton
This venue specializes in stationary cycling exercises, but don’t knock it until you try it. If you’ve never experienced SoulCycle before, you have no idea what an intense and revelatory workout you are missing.
68 Newtown Lane, East Hampton, soulcycle.com
Well Within
Whether you’re looking for an intense session of calorie-burning exercise or something a bit more calming and contemplative, Well Within is the spot for you. It offers options such as aromatherapy yoga, Surfset, and “hard-core” Pilates. This multi-location venue helps you find inner wellness and peace.
